function doPost(e) {
try {
const params = JSON.parse(e.postData.contents);
if (params.help) {
return ContentService.createTextOutput(JSON.stringify({
success: true,
data: `Guide:
- Mandatory parameters: sheetId, sheetName, method, data
- Methods:
- append: Adds new rows with the provided data
- edit: Edits a single row based on the filter criteria
- editAll: Edits all rows matching the filter criteria
- delete: Deletes a single row based on the filter criteria
- deleteAll: Deletes all rows matching the filter criteria
- Data format:
- append: [{"column1":"value1", "column2":"value2", ...}]
- edit, editAll: { "filter": [{"column":"value"}, ...], "edit": [{"column":"value"}, ...] }
- delete, deleteAll: { "filter": [{"column":"value"}, ...] }`
})).setMimeType(ContentService.MimeType.JSON);
}
const { sheetId, sheetName, method, data } = params;
if (!sheetId || !sheetName || !method || !data) {
throw new Error("Missing mandatory parameters: \"sheetId\", \"sheetName\", \"method\", or \"data\"");
}
const ss = SpreadsheetApp.openById(sheetId);
const sheet = ss.getSheetByName(sheetName);
if (!sheet) {
throw new Error(`Sheet "${sheetName}" not found in the provided spreadsheet.`);
}
const dataRange = sheet.getDataRange().getValues();
const [headerRow, ...rows] = dataRange;
switch (method) {
case 'append':
return appendData(sheet, headerRow, data);
case 'edit':
return editData(sheet, headerRow, rows, data, false);
case 'editAll':
return editData(sheet, headerRow, rows, data, true);
case 'delete':
return deleteData(sheet, headerRow, rows, data, false);
case 'deleteAll':
return deleteData(sheet, headerRow, rows, data, true);
default:
throw new Error(`Invalid method: "${method}". Valid methods are: append, edit, editAll, delete, deleteAll`);
}
} catch (error) {
return ContentService.createTextOutput(JSON.stringify({
success: false,
data: error.message
})).setMimeType(ContentService.MimeType.JSON);
}
}
function appendData(sheet, headerRow, data) {
const newRows = data.map(item => {
return headerRow.map(header => item[header] || "");
});
sheet.getRange(sheet.getLastRow() + 1, 1, newRows.length, newRows[0].length).setValues(newRows);
return ContentService.createTextOutput(JSON.stringify({
success: true,
data: "Data appended successfully"
})).setMimeType(ContentService.MimeType.JSON);
}
function editData(sheet, headerRow, rows, data, editAll) {
const { filter, edit } = data;
const filterObj = filter.reduce((obj, { column, value }) => {
obj[column] = value;
return obj;
}, {});
const editObj = edit.reduce((obj, { column, value }) => {
obj[column] = value;
return obj;
}, {});
const filteredRows = rows.map((row, index) => {
const rowObj = headerRow.reduce((obj, header, i) => {
obj[header] = row[i];
return obj;
}, {});
return { rowObj, index };
}).filter(({ rowObj }) => {
return Object.keys(filterObj).every(key => rowObj[key] === filterObj[key]);
});
if (filteredRows.length === 0) {
throw new Error("No matching rows found.");
}
if (!editAll && filteredRows.length > 1) {
throw new Error("Multiple matching rows found.");
}
filteredRows.forEach(({ index }) => {
const rowIndex = index + 2; // Account for header row
Object.keys(editObj).forEach(key => {
const colIndex = headerRow.indexOf(key) + 1;
if (colIndex < 1) {
throw new Error(`Invalid column: "${key}"`);
}
sheet.getRange(rowIndex, colIndex).setValue(editObj[key]);
});
});
return ContentService.createTextOutput(JSON.stringify({
success: true,
data: "Data edited successfully"
})).setMimeType(ContentService.MimeType.JSON);
}
function deleteData(sheet, headerRow, rows, data, deleteAll) {
const filterObj = data.filter.reduce((obj, { column, value }) => {
obj[column] = value;
return obj;
}, {});
const filteredRows = rows.map((row, index) => {
const rowObj = headerRow.reduce((obj, header, i) => {
obj[header] = row[i];
return obj;
}, {});
return { rowObj, index };
}).filter(({ rowObj }) => {
return Object.keys(filterObj).every(key => rowObj[key] === filterObj[key]);
});
if (filteredRows.length === 0) {
throw new Error("No matching rows found.");
}
if (!deleteAll && filteredRows.length > 1) {
throw new Error("Multiple matching rows found.");
}
// Collect row indices to delete, sorted in descending order
const rowsToDelete = filteredRows.map(({ index }) => index + 2).sort((a, b) => b - a);
rowsToDelete.forEach(rowIndex => {
sheet.deleteRow(rowIndex);
});
return ContentService.createTextOutput(JSON.stringify({
success: true,
data: "Data deleted successfully"
})).setMimeType(ContentService.MimeType.JSON);
}
